Miami 33187 roof & property reports.
5,382 assessed properties in Miami 33187: average roof age ~19 years, 53% past the 15-year insurability threshold.

About Miami 33187 reports.
Each address page shows a computed roof score, permit-backed roof age where available, material, FEMA flood zone, wind zone, and a qualitative insurance profile, all from public records.
Coverage rolls out metro by metro, prioritizing addresses with complete county records. Missing addresses join as their county data is ingested.
